ABAR Suffield is excited to announce a new community offering. ABAR will be hosting regular movie screenings followed by a group discussion facilitated by an ABAR member. On Wednesday, February 15th ABAR was proud to kick off this initiative with a screening of the film Till at the Kent Memorial Library. Following the movie, a robust discussion took place amongst attendees. This is a great way for those looking to learn and/or engage with fellow community members in a safe space.
